Mental Illness Awareness Week: What You Should Know
Established in 1990, Mental Illness Awareness Week takes place in the USA the first full week of October. Though there have been some major strides in raising awareness of mental health issues, it remains largely stigmatized in the media and among specific gender and race groups. How To Make Yogurt Without A Yogurt Maker
Yogurt is a great, kid-friendly source of natural probiotics, an integral part of a healthy diet. Eating live culture yogurt helps maintain the balance of microflora in the intestines, bolsters the immune system, and alleviates food allergies.
